getting mail from spool broken?

From: Gijs Hillenius
Subject: getting mail from spool broken?
Date: Sun, 06 Apr 2008 18:18:30 +0200
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/23.0.60 (gnu/linux)


This might be something for an all-emacs news group, not sure. Apologies
if I am in the wrong group...

I'm using Gnus v5.13, and an hour or so ago upgraded to a very recent
emacs from cvs. ( )

This upgrade seems to have broken gnus getting mail from the local 

If I start gnus, I get

Mail source (file) error (stringp).  Continue? (yes or no
if yes, I get the usual gnus, but there is not mail fetched from the
spool. Hittin [1-5]g (1g, 2g etcetera) gives the same error. 

switching on debuging and [1-5]g gives:

Debugger entered--Lisp error: (wrong-type-argument stringp (or (getenv
  "MAIL") (expand-file-name (user-login-name) rmail-spool-directory)))
  file-truename((or (getenv "MAIL") (expand-file-name (user-login-name)

and some more lines

What to do?

